Mental Health in Malone, AL - What is Mental Health

The definition of mental health is the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ral state. In short, our mental health is the state of our minds. It can impact everything from how we think and feel, to how we act and how our bodies respond to certain situations and stimuli.

Our mental health can have a major impact on our overall quality of life. Our relationships, careers, and finances can all suffer. It effects our self-esteem, influences how we make decisions, how we communicate, and even our ability to learn.

Although it may be an intangible aspect of our overall health, our mental health how we interact with the rest of the world. How our minds operate, ultimately controls who we are as individuals.

Types of Mental Health Providers in Malone, AL

No two people with mental illness experience it in the exact same way. As such, there are various types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.

Psychologists in Malone

Psychologists are trained and educated to conduct psychological evaluations and provide diagnoses. They’re highly adept at hel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. The majority of treatment revolves around ident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.

Psychiatrists in Malone

Sometimes there is a need for more immediate or intense treatment than what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Although they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.

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Malone

All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als with a masters-level education in fields such as psychology, marriage and family therapy, or other specialties. As they are not medical doctors, they address m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. More often than not, individual and group therapy is the primary mode of treatment offered.

Paying for Malone Mental Health Treatment

Paying for mental health treatment is going to look different from person to person, depending on their financial needs. First would be speaking with your insurance provider and having them make recommendations based on your healthcare plan’s coverage. Option 2 is out-of-pocket payment. This is a typical option for those who select a mental health rehab not covered by their insurance, or in the absence of healthcare coverage. The final option would be to search for a state-funded program if you are uninsured or lack the financial resources to pay privately.
